Description
18th century Swedish Baroque wall cabinet in it's original, distressed blue-green color. ca 1750 - 1780 Sweden.
Height: 26.37 in (67 cm)
Width: 20.47 in (52 cm)
Depth: 9.44 in (24 cm)
Good condition with visible signs of wear consistent with use and age. Key escutcheon historically changed. Dry scraped to reveal the original finish. -
